Trial of Texas Teen in High School Stabbing Case

The murder trial of 19-year-old Karmelo Anthony began in Texas, with prosecutors and the defense providing different narratives about the incident. Anthony, charged with the stabbing death of 17-year-old Austin Metcalf during a high school track meet, claims self-defense, according to his lawyer, Mike Howard.

Defense and Prosecution Arguments

Howard stated that Anthony acted out of “fear and chaos.” He noted that after Anthony used the knife in self-defense, he didn’t stab again and dropped the weapon. Prosecutor Bill Wirskye countered this claim, asserting that the case involves “unjustified provoked murder.” He stressed that race did not play a role in the case, despite the fact that Anthony is Black and Metcalf was white.

Jury Selection Controversy

A civil rights group, Next Generation Action Network, criticized the jury’s composition, noting the absence of Black jurors and accusing the prosecution of barring them. The organization insisted on fairness and equal justice while respecting the court’s processes.

Details of the Incident

Metcalf’s father, Jeff, recounted that his son, who had a 4.0 GPA and was an MVP in football, was stabbed in the chest and died in his twin brother’s arms. The family described Austin as a promising young man on the right path, headed for college.

Case Developments

Following the incident in June 2025, Anthony was charged with first-degree murder. Collin County District Attorney Greg Willis acknowledged the community’s emotional response to the event. If convicted, Anthony, considered an adult under Texas law, could face a sentence ranging from 5 years to life in prison.

Anthony has been released on a $250,000 bond and is under house arrest. He successfully graduated high school with a 3.7 GPA, although barred from senior graduation activities.

Community Support

A crowdfunding campaign has raised over $1.4 million to support Anthony’s legal and relocation expenses, highlighting the significant public support and attention this case has garnered.
